WebFrederic Remington (1861 – 1909) was an American painter, illustrator, and sculptor specializing in the American Old West’s depictions. Remington’s artworks depict the Western United States at the end of the 1800s, featuring such images as cowboys, American Indians, and the United States Cavalry.

Expressionism was a movement which originated in Germany and is regarded as one of the most influential art movements of the 20th century. Its artists distorted form and used strong colors to express emotional experience rather than physical reality.
